The Box-English

The cruise part 5.

The cruise part 5.

Apr 21, 2025

 Fernández's point of view

There was less and less time left, this was the first group to arrive at The Box’s facilities. Throughout this week, more trips would be made on this same cruise for all the other groups.

Before dinner, I was able to watch several sparrings between them from the camera room. Although most were just to pass the time among friends, it was enough to make me even more excited about seeing them face each other seriously in The Box. I couldn’t wait. Suddenly, I couldn’t help but smile as I saw an interesting situation through one of the cameras. "Looks like they can’t either."



Lorenzo's point of view

After leaving the dining room, we headed to one of the many leisure areas on the cruise. We bought drinks from a vending machine and entered a recreational zone. The colorful lights and the various games were really eye-catching — it had been years since I’d had time to visit places like this.

To begin with, we decided to play a round of bowling. Despite my lack of experience, I didn’t do so badly and managed to come in second. David came in first without much effort; he always threw the balls to the same spot calmly with a slight margin of error. Joan, on the other hand, well… let’s just say more balls went off the lane than stayed on it.

After this horrible performance, Joan suggested a game of ping pong to try to redeem himself. We took turns playing; the winner stayed at the table and waited for the next opponent.

Joan was quite good at playing, maintaining his champion status until the end.

"Is there room for one more? Said an unfamiliar voice.

"Ohh, is a new challenger approaching?" Said Joan proudly, smiling.

"Who are you?" David asked cautiously.

"Lucas López, pleasure to meet you" Said the stranger, extending his hand with a smile.

"Likewise, I'm Lorenzo, this is David, and the very lively champion over there is Joan" I said, shaking his hand.

"Well, Joan, how about a match?" Said Lucas smiling as he approached the table.

"Of course" Answered Joan.

A moment later, the game had already started. Everything proceeded normally until Joan finally decided to use a spin shot — the same one that had beaten both David and me before, a shot hard to predict for any beginner.

Point. 

As expected, Lucas wasn’t able to stop Joan’s shot, but he didn’t seem angry. Rather, he looked surprised. I could even swear I saw him smile.

Joan needed just one more point to win. Everything continued normally until Joan throwed his spin shot again, but at that moment, Lucas showed a big smile.

Point.

 David looked just as surprised as I did by what had just happened — Lucas not only avoided Joan’s shot, but returned it using the same spin technique.

"I thought you were a rookie. Have you been letting me win?" Said Joan, surprised.

"Of course not, I really don’t play this much, it was just luck." Lucas replied with a smile.

After that, there were no more surprises. Joan scored one last point and remained the champion. Since we were tired, we decided to head to our rooms and Lucas offered to join us; he didn’t seem to know anyone else.

Once outside, we saw a machine for measuring punch power — it was impossible not to want to try it.

"This is what I'm really good at." Said Joan, smiling excited.

"In my opinion, you'd better stick to ping pong" Said David, trying to tease him.

Joan ignored him and proceeded to throw a powerful right. Unlike in a fight, he could take the liberty of winding up the punch and building power. 973 points. "Beat that if you can, shorty" Said Joan, smiling.

"Are you proud of that?" Said an unfamiliar voice.

We all turned around, and at that moment we saw a small group led by a young guy with dark skin who seemed about my height.

"If that's all you've got, maybe you should just jump off the ship now" He continued.

"And who are you supposed to be? I'd at least like to know who I’m going to beat up" Said Joan, furious.

"Bruno Khattabi, though you probably won’t remember after you get knocked out" He said, stepping forward threateningly.

They were only a few meters apart frontera each other and didn’t seem willing to listen to reason, so the best thing I could think of was to try to step in and separate them.

"If you have issues, why not settle them tomorrow with a sparring match?" I said, stepping between them, when suddenly and without warning, I felt a strong punch land on my cheek.

"Sparring? These little professional kids don’t fight unless they’ve got the protection and comfort of their gloves. In my neighborhood, they wouldn’t last a single day — those are real fights" Said Bruno while shaking his right hand after hitting me. "Who's next?" He added with a smile.

Joan looked like he was about to lunge at him when Lucas stopped him and helped me up. "I hope you're okay with me" He said, looking calmly at Bruno.

David helped me stay on my feet while Lucas approached Bruno. I couldn't believe that for a moment I’d forgotten that everyone on this cruise was a boxer. I knew I had to stop the fight, but I was really curious about their skills.

Again by surprise, Bruno lunged at Lucas, who still seemed calm. He started with a simple one-two, though his technique was a bit odd. But Lucas dodged it easily. It continued like this until, after a failed right hook, Bruno used the momentum to spin on himself and throw another one — Lucas barely managed to dodge it.

"Pivot punch..." Said David
"...an illegal move in boxing."

The fight continued with Lucas dodging all of Bruno's punches using quick footwork, but refusing to counterattack. What I didn’t expect was what happened next.

Bruno, tired of being dodged, stepped on Lucas’s foot to stop him from escaping and threw a powerful right. But… at the very moment the punch was about to land, Lucas managed to free his foot, though it was already too late to dodge. So instead, he did something that surprised us all.

Lucas took the punch by slightly turning his head — a common boxing technique — but the surprising part was that he used the momentum of Bruno’s punch to spin on himself, counterattacking with a pivot punch that stopped just in front of Bruno’s face.

"Need more?" Said Lucas, emotionless.

"No need, I’ve seen enough. Go to bed already" Said a voice from a speaker that surprised us all. Fernández seemed to have been watching from the start.

Bruno and his group turned around and left without saying a word. After confirming they were gone, we said our goodbyes and everyone went to their room.

As for me, even though I’d been punched, all I could think about on the way to my room was how beautiful the stars looked that night.

"In today's era, due to corruption, boxing has been stripped of the prestige and honor it once had. As a result, 'The Box' is born. Our story follows the life of Lorenzo, a young boxer who, after not only losing a fight but also being unable to save his gym, decides to join 'The Box,' an ambitious project led by a retired boxer who, together with 350 young pugilists, will try to reinvent boxing and show the world what they are capable of".
